319 Aengus Ó Snodaigh asked the Minister for Foreign Affairs if the 25 troops and crew on board the US C130 Hercules en route from a US Air Force based in Germany to Newfoundland, Canada, that made an emergency landing at Shannon earlier in June 2005 were armed or were carrying personal weapons. [23900/05]
